Born at Livermore Valley Memorial Hospital, Jake is a third-generation Livermore resident with an extensive local network and rich family tradition in real estate. He brings unique market knowledge of Livermore and the Tri-Valley acquired over decades of personal experience and family history to every client engagement.

Jake is passionate about serving his community.

Jake began his teaching career at Marylin Avenue Elementary School in 2011, working with students with moderate to severe disabilities. He currently teaches at Christensen Middle School, where he’s involved with the school’s leadership team and has coached golf and basketball. Christensen Middle School is also where he met Michael when they were in 7th grade. With mutually shared interests in sports (especially basketball, as they were the only two players on their team who their coach gave awarded the “green light” to shoot 3s), video games, and girls, they eventually became best friends. Over wine and a fire pit in Jake’s backyard in the summer of 2017, the idea of launching a real estate business partnership was proposed by Jake. With Michael’s background in real estate investing and brokerage paired with Jake’s extensive network and passion to serve his community, MH Real Estate Company was formed with the intention of helping as many people as possible navigate important and complex real estate decisions. Jake would focus on Livermore and the Tri-Valley, while Michael would support him and continue his own brokerage efforts in San Francisco and neighboring cities.
